Output df81c8bb74b228564b660a736f5ced7e59af30c12ddc092d79c3fb6b78aa32ca:18

value
250362
script pubkey
OP_0 OP_PUSHBYTES_20 64f89bcf046b4e2fd886814f1a2a5995152e9f21
address
bc1qvnufhncydd8zlkyxs98352jej52ja8epsmrcyp
transaction
df81c8bb74b228564b660a736f5ced7e59af30c12ddc092d79c3fb6b78aa32ca
confirmations
177191
spent
true